1. Understanding Player Perceptions of Difficulty in Casual Games
a. How players interpret and evaluate game challenge levels
Players do not perceive difficulty in a vacuum; their interpretation is shaped by their cognitive biases, past experiences, and immediate context. For instance, a puzzle that appears straightforward to a seasoned gamer might seem daunting to a newcomer. The perception of challenge is often mediated by personal thresholds for effort and problem-solving. Studies indicate that players tend to evaluate difficulty relative to their perceived ability, leading some to underestimate or overestimate the challenge based on their confidence level or prior successes.
b. The role of prior gaming experiences and individual skill perception
A player’s history with similar game genres heavily influences their perception of difficulty. An experienced casual gamer familiar with match-three mechanics, for example, may find new titles within the same genre less challenging than a novice. Furthermore, individual skill perception—how players view their own abilities—can lead to adaptive difficulty choices. When players believe they are competent, they are more inclined to opt for higher challenge levels, seeking mastery. Conversely, players doubting their skills might prefer easier settings to avoid frustration.
c. Cultural and demographic influences on difficulty perception
Cultural backgrounds and demographics also shape difficulty interpretation. For example, players from cultures emphasizing perseverance may be more willing to accept challenging tasks, viewing difficulty as a pathway to achievement. Age factors matter as well; younger players might have different thresholds for frustration compared to older players, influencing their difficulty preferences. Additionally, language and societal norms about competition and failure can alter how players perceive and respond to game challenges.
2. The Psychological Drivers Behind Difficulty Preferences
a. The desire for achievement and mastery
Many players are motivated by a fundamental desire to master game mechanics and achieve high scores or unlock achievements. This drive pushes players toward selecting higher difficulty settings to challenge themselves and experience a sense of accomplishment. For example, competitive puzzle games like Candy Crush often include optional higher difficulty modes that appeal to players seeking mastery.
b. The impact of flow state and challenge-skill balance
The concept of flow—being fully immersed in an activity—depends on balancing challenge with skill. When difficulty aligns well with a player’s ability, engagement intensifies. Casual games that dynamically adjust difficulty aim to maintain this flow state, encouraging players to stay immersed without feeling overwhelmed or bored.
c. Avoidance of frustration and desire for immediate gratification
Some players prefer lower difficulty levels to minimize frustration and maximize quick wins, aligning with their need for immediate satisfaction. This is especially common in casual gaming, where players often seek light entertainment without the risk of failure deterring continued play. Developers often implement “easy mode” options or hints to cater to this psychological preference.
3. How Player Expectations Shape Difficulty Selection
a. Influence of game tutorials and onboarding processes
Effective onboarding sets initial expectations about difficulty. For example, a tutorial that emphasizes the game’s forgiving mechanics may lead players to expect an accessible experience, influencing their choice of difficulty. Conversely, games that showcase challenging boss fights early on might prime players for higher difficulty levels from the outset.
b. The role of marketing and game presentation in setting difficulty expectations
Marketing materials, trailers, and app store descriptions shape perceptions even before gameplay begins. A game advertised with phrases like “easy to pick up” or “challenging puzzles” primes players to select specific difficulty modes aligned with their expectations. Misalignment between marketing and actual difficulty can lead to disappointment or disengagement.
c. Player assumptions based on genre conventions and branding
Genre cues influence difficulty expectations. For example, casual match-three games are generally perceived as accessible, leading players to anticipate minimal challenge. When a game defies genre norms—offering unexpectedly high difficulty—it can disrupt player expectations and affect their perception of fairness and engagement.
4. The Impact of Player Feedback and Community on Difficulty Perception
a. How reviews and social interactions alter difficulty expectations
Player reviews and social media discussions significantly influence perceptions. For instance, if early reviews highlight the game’s high difficulty, new players may approach it with caution or choose lower settings. Conversely, positive community feedback about manageable difficulty can encourage players to challenge themselves more.
b. The effect of shared strategies and community tips on perceived difficulty
Communities often exchange strategies that can make difficult levels seem more approachable, effectively lowering perceived difficulty. For example, walkthroughs and tip-sharing forums empower players to overcome challenging sections, reducing frustration and altering their difficulty perception.
c. Adaptive feedback mechanisms responding to player perceptions
Some modern casual games incorporate adaptive difficulty systems that respond to player performance and feedback. These mechanisms help maintain an optimal challenge level, preventing players from feeling bored or overwhelmed, thus aligning difficulty with evolving perceptions and skills.
5. Non-Obvious Factors Influencing Difficulty Choices
a. Emotional state and psychological readiness at the time of play
A player’s mood and emotional resilience heavily influence their perception of challenge. For example, a player feeling stressed or distracted may opt for easier difficulty settings to avoid additional frustration. Conversely, a motivated or confident player might pursue higher challenges, seeking to test their limits.
b. The influence of game aesthetics and interface design on perceived challenge
Visual clarity, interface responsiveness, and aesthetic appeal can mitigate or amplify perceived difficulty. A cluttered or confusing interface may increase perceived challenge, while clean, intuitive designs can make levels feel more approachable, regardless of actual difficulty.
c. External factors such as device performance and environmental distractions
Performance issues like lag or low battery can impair gameplay, causing players to perceive levels as more difficult than intended. Additionally, environmental distractions—noise, interruptions—can influence a player’s mental state and perception of challenge, prompting a preference for easier modes during such times.
6. Designing for Player Perception: Balancing Challenge and Accessibility
a. Implementing adjustable difficulty levels aligned with player perceptions
Allowing players to modify difficulty settings empowers them to tailor their experience, aligning with their perception of challenge. For example, many casual games feature multiple difficulty modes, with clear labels and descriptions to help players choose appropriately. This flexibility respects individual differences and improves long-term engagement.
b. Using dynamic difficulty adjustment to match evolving player skills
Dynamic difficulty systems analyze player performance in real-time, adjusting challenge levels to maintain engagement. Titles like Angry Birds and Clash of Clans utilize such mechanisms, ensuring players remain in a state of flow without feeling overwhelmed or bored. This approach aligns difficulty with individual perception, which evolves as players improve.
c. Communicating difficulty cues effectively to manage expectations
Clear visual and auditory cues about level difficulty—such as difficulty icons, color schemes, or descriptive text—help set appropriate expectations. Transparent communication minimizes mismatches between perceived and actual challenge, fostering trust and encouraging players to explore higher difficulty modes confidently.
7. Bridging Player Perceptions and Default Difficulty Settings
a. How default difficulty shapes initial perception and subsequent choices
Default difficulty acts as the initial lens through which players interpret the game’s challenge. A default setting perceived as too easy may lead players to assume the game is unchallenging, reducing their motivation to explore higher levels. Conversely, a default perceived as well-balanced can create a positive first impression, encouraging players to challenge themselves further.
b. Strategies for developers to align default settings with targeted player perceptions
Developers can leverage data analytics and player feedback to calibrate default difficulty that matches their core audience’s expectations. For instance, if analytics show players often switch to easier levels, the default might be set slightly higher to foster engagement. A/B testing different defaults can also reveal optimal settings to match perceived challenge levels.
c. The importance of transparent communication about difficulty design to influence perception and engagement
Explaining how difficulty levels are designed and what they entail helps players set realistic expectations. For example, including brief descriptions or preview videos for each difficulty mode can guide players to select options aligned with their skill and mood, fostering a sense of control and satisfaction.
